1H-indole-2,5-dicarboxylic acid is a versatile organic molecule characterized by its indole core and two strategically positioned carboxylic acid groups. This dicarboxylic nature is precisely what makes it an excellent building block for MOFs. In the synthesis of MOFs, organic linkers act as bridges, connecting metal ions or metal clusters to form a three-dimensional network. The two carboxylic acid functionalities of 1H-indole-2,5-dicarboxylic acid can readily coordinate with metal centers, facilitating the self-assembly process into crystalline, porous structures. The indole ring itself contributes to the overall framework, influencing its electronic properties and potential interactions with guest molecules.

The synthesis of MOFs utilizing 1H-indole-2,5-dicarboxylic acid typically involves solvothermal methods. This process generally combines the organic linker with metal salts (e.g., zinc, copper, or cobalt salts) in a solvent system, often a mixture of DMF and water, and subjects the mixture to elevated temperatures in a sealed vessel. The precise reaction conditions, including temperature, solvent composition, and reactant ratios, can be fine-tuned to control the resulting MOF's topology, pore size, and crystallinity. The unique structural features imparted by the indole moiety can lead to MOFs with interesting properties. For instance, the aromatic nature of the indole ring can enhance π-π stacking interactions within the framework, potentially influencing adsorption properties for specific gases or catalytic activity. Furthermore, the electronic characteristics of the indole nucleus can be exploited in optoelectronic applications.
